Warshawsky Muffler Rockford ILWarshawsky Mufflers (Gone)
Rockford, IL
Photos courtesy Kelly Sullivan

Here are a couple of photos of Warshawsky Muffler in Rockford, IL. The shop's friendly cartoon muffler hanging from the side of the building made it almost impossible to drive by without smiling. It's not every day you see a muffler waving hello. 09-10

The family-owned business spent more than 70 years repairing mufflers, exhaust systems, and trailer hitches. While the work brought customers in, it was the building itself that made the shop memorable. Painted cartoon mufflers and exhaust pipes stretched along the exterior walls, giving the place a sense of humor that fit right in with old roadside America.

It's always fun when a business puts a little personality into its sign instead of settling for a plain logo. The smiling muffler did exactly what a good roadside sign should do—it caught your attention and made you remember the place.

Warshawsky Muffler Rockford ILUnfortunately, the shop became part of a downtown redevelopment project. After a lengthy eminent domain process, the property was acquired by the city and the building was eventually demolished.

UPDATE: Warshawsky Mufflers is gone today, and the cartoon muffler sign disappeared along with the building. The site has since been redeveloped for municipal parking and public art. 07-26
